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Watford to Kotor is to fly and bus which costs €95 - €350 and takes 11h 15m.
The fastest way to get from Watford to Kotor is to fly which takes 5h 55m and costs €160 - €450.
No, there is no direct bus from Watford to Kotor. However, there are services departing from Beechen Grove and arriving at Kotor, Autobuska Stanica via Edgware Bus Station, Bounds Green Road London and Tirana, Terminali Lindor I Autobusave.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 37h 45m.
The distance between Watford and Kotor is 1802 km.
The best way to get from Watford to Kotor without a car is to train and bus via Karlsruhe which takes 31h 11m and costs €330 - €850.
It takes approximately 6h 18m to get from Watford to Kotor, including transfers.
Watford to Kotor bus services, operated by Anumi Travel, depart from Bounds Green Road London station.
The best way to get from Watford to Kotor is to fly which takes 6h 18m and costs €130 - €350.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s and takes 37h 45m.
Watford to Kotor bus services, operated by Anumi Travel, arrive at Tirana station.
Kotor is 1h ahead of Watford. It is currently 12:49 PM in Watford and 1:49 PM in Kotor.
